New Zealand had the pleasure of Quintais, Suchaud and Rocher visit us in February 2008 (see our website www.petanquenz.com - although I didn't personally get to know them, the kiwi's who did host them found all 3 to be a pleasure knowing. Suchaud and Rocher had very little English, but by all accounts Quintais had a very good grasp of English and an excellent sense of humour. How did NZ get such esteemed Petanque company? Courtesy of Victor Nataf the French coach who we met in Melbourne Australia at a Trans-Tasman Tournament (NZ vs Australia) where Victor and Claude Raouley (sp?) were running a coaching session with the Aussie and kiwi coaches. Dinner with Victor & Claude and the oil of vino led to the wonderful experience of having international petanque champions at our shores.
